Publisher DNA
What defines Paul Femiak?
Publisher DNA
Primary focus
Mixed portfolio: Industrial utilities and surreal narrative games
Scale
indie
Target audience
A split audience consisting of upstream oil and gas professionals requiring field-ready calculators and fans of internet-native, surreal horror aesthetics.
Signature Patterns
- •Bifurcated development strategy targeting both professional utilities and niche gaming
- •Monetization mix utilizing both free-to-play and paid-upfront models
- •Focus on offline-capable functionality for utility-based applications
- •Integration of atmospheric and narrative-heavy elements in gaming titles
Portfolio momentum
With 12 releases in the last 6 months and active development across both gaming and productivity verticals, the publisher maintains a high-frequency update cadence.
